What the data says about the New Haven full-service restaurants market

According to U.S. Census Bureau data, there are 571 full-service restaurants serving the New Haven, CT area (population 568,158) — 100.5 per 100,000 residents. That's +41% above the typical U.S. metro (71.5 per 100k), making New Haven more saturated than 92% of the 387 metros we track.

For context, the national average is 76.8 per 100k — higher than the typical metro because dense urban areas pull it up. The New Haven, CT population grew 0.7% from 2020 to 2023, a signal of flat local demand.
